Lake Havasu Area Chamber of Commerce members, partnering organizations and supporters gathered near the London Bridge this week to celebrate community leaders and their impact on the Lake Havasu City community. The chamber honored participants Friday evening for their achievements in hospitality, business outreach, efforts in bettering their community - and special recognition for the 2024 Chamber of Commerce Citizen of the Year, City Councilman David Lane. The vent featured food, refreshments and a 1980s theme at the Shugrue's Restaurant Bridgeview Room, as many participants attended in fashions - and enjoyed musical selections - which were highlights of American culture 40 years ago.

Those celebrated on Friday also included Chamber Ambassador of the Year Cheryl Ramsden, of the National Bank of Arizona; Leadership of Lake Havasu Distinguished Alumni (and City Councilwoman) Jeni Coke; "Rising Star" Rick Riegler, of the Lake Havasu Marine Association; "Bridge to Business" award winner Joelle Dickinson, of the London Bridge Resort; and "Spirit of Hospitality" award winner, Western Arizona Vocational Education (WAVE). Also recognized were Chamber Volunteer of the Year Ross Johnson; "Elevating Havasu" award winners, the Lake Havasu Rotary Club; "Ethics in Business" award winners Janene Samp and Kenny Samp, of Sunset Charter and Tours; "Community Enhancement" award winners, Desert Land Group; and "Pinnacle Award" winner, the London Bridge Resort..
